Subject: Memorandum submitted to President, United States of America, Washington, D.C. regarding the current heinous crime committed by the state Government of Manipur India against Indigenous tribal people.
The Prime Minister of India,
With due respect, we the minority indigenous tribal Christians of Manipur state, India have been facing lots of unbearable discrimination for the past decades from bias led government in Manipur. For the past many decades the minority Christians in Manipur were just a silent victims in all aspects of life under this unjust and corrupted leadership.
Time and again, recently Manipur state Assembly which is non tribals majority leadership forcibly approved the three Bills without the consent of minority Christians in Manipur, which erupted anger and violence among communities in the state. Many houses were gutted into ashes, many people were killed by the state security forces and hundreds injured.
We the Kuki Inpi, United States of America would like to draw your kind special attention for the said issues faced by the indigenous Tribals of Manipur, India. Your timely intervention and support to impose President rule in the state may safeguard the indigenous tribals of Manipur. We shall be very grateful to you ever.
